Frequently asked questions

How many threatened species are in Timor-Leste?
Timor-Leste has 55 threatened species recorded in the SpeciesRadar database — 10 of those are Critically Endangered (CR), facing an extremely high risk of extinction. The figures combine IUCN Red List data with national red list assessments where available.
What is the most endangered species in Timor-Leste?
Among the 10 Critically Endangered species in Timor-Leste, Sphyrna lewini is one of the most at-risk — featured prominently on the country dashboard. The full list of CR species is filterable on the country page.
